Gear refers to a number of supplements and steroids that help boost your workout performance. Many types of gear are available, such as whey protein, creatine, pre-workout boosters, post-workout products, etc. 

Each has its purpose for improving overall bodybuilding health. Whey protein is popular among those who want to bulk up because it’s packed with amino acids. 

Creatine is also a great supplement to help you lift more weight and recover from your workouts faster. Pre-workout boosters will give you an extra dose of energy so that you can work out longer, while post-workout products are used for recovery purposes after strenuous exercises.

Are Anabolic Steroids Illegal?

Yes, anabolic steroids are illegal. They are considered a controlled substance by the United States government, and other countries around the world have similar laws regarding steroid use. There can be severe consequences if you are caught using these substances without valid medical reasons for their use.

According to the US National Library of Medicine, anabolic steroids are defined as “a drug that acts like testosterone and dihydrotestosterone in the body. They help with athletic performance and muscle growth.” The Steroid Education website says they have been used since 1954.

A doctor from Harvard Medical School began using them for medical reasons such as “the restoration of pituitary function in certain types of dwarfism.” The site says that the drugs then began being used by bodybuilders and other athletes for their muscle-building effects.
